Matt's user avatar
Matt's user avatar
Matt's user avatar
Matt
  • Member for 12 years, 9 months
  • Last seen more than a month ago
  • Boston, MA
217 votes
7 answers
183k views

Does a break statement break from a switch/select?

123 votes
5 answers
162k views

How can I iterate over a string by runes in Go?

73 votes
13 answers
86k views

How can you get the clipboard contents with a Windows command?

54 votes
5 answers
37k views

Is there any way to access private fields of a struct from another package?

28 votes
4 answers
8k views

In C#, is a Debug.Assert test run in release mode?

25 votes
4 answers
29k views

How can I run a static initializer method in C# before the Main() method?

24 votes
3 answers
108k views

In C how do you redirect stdin/stdout/stderr to files when making an execvp() or similar call?

23 votes
3 answers
6k views

How can I incorporate ternary operators into a precedence climbing algorithm?

23 votes
2 answers
13k views

How can I clean up after an error in a Makefile?

22 votes
6 answers
18k views

Is there any way to compile additional code at runtime in C or C++?

22 votes
2 answers
18k views

Where can I download the source code to the GNU C++ Standard Library?

21 votes
2 answers
18k views

How can I remove the margins around text in a WPF label?

21 votes
1 answer
5k views

Do C/C++ compilers such as GCC generally optimize modulo by a constant power of 2?

20 votes
4 answers
46k views

How do you redirect standard input to a file in the Windows command line?

19 votes
3 answers
2k views

Is it bad practice to overload a function to take both a pointer or a reference?

18 votes
4 answers
11k views

In C#, how do you mix a default get with an explicit set?

17 votes
2 answers
7k views

Why is there no "recalloc" in the C standard?

16 votes
1 answer
10k views

How are shifts implemented on the hardware level?

16 votes
2 answers
329 views

Initializing circular data in C. Is this valid C code according to any standard?

14 votes
2 answers
32k views

How can I use CSS to insert a line break after but not before an element?

13 votes
1 answer
334 views

In C++, is a constructor with only default arguments a default constructor?

13 votes
5 answers
376 views

In C#, why do interface implementations have to implement a another version of a method explicitly?

12 votes
2 answers
5k views

How can I replace UTF-8 errors in Ruby without converting to a different encoding?

11 votes
1 answer
10k views

Determining whitespace in Go

9 votes
2 answers
835 views

Is there any way for a C++ template function to take exactly N arguments?

9 votes
8 answers
2k views

How can I reduce the stack frame of a deeply recursive function in C?

9 votes
5 answers
16k views

What is the best way to seed srand()? [duplicate]

7 votes
1 answer
1k views

What exactly is the purpose of syntax objects in scheme?

7 votes
2 answers
780 views

In R6RS Scheme, is there a way to get the current environment for use with eval?

7 votes
3 answers
1k views

Does a templated constructor override the implicit copy constructor in C++?

1
2 3 4 5